Ashley O'Quinn

Owner/Artistic Director

Ms. Ashley began her early dance training in her hometown of New Bern, NC, but in her years later received most of her training in Wilmington, NC when her family moved there. She performed in the Nutcracker with roles as the Arabian. At that time, she also began to evolve into the competitive world of dance and began taking master classes, intensives, and began auditioning and competing with her routines, earning her numerous regional and national scholarships and titles. In addition to her scholarships, she also received multiple awards for Highest Scoring Soloist of the Day, Highest Scoring Routine of the Weekend, and other top ranking titles. A routine she performed in was also featured on ESPN2 from their live competition broadcast.  She was a scholarship recipient from ​​​​​​​Dance Spirit Magazine where she was featured in their October 2002 edition. Ashley has over 20 years of dance training, over 16 years of experience as a teaching professional, and has also been a guest artist and choreographer for studios and companies up and down the east coast.  Her specialties include ballet, pointe, acro (acrobatics), lyrical, contemporary, and jazz. 

Many of her students have won many high-ranking awards, Overall High Score dance awards and prestigious scholarships at state, regional, and national dance competitions across the country, been accepted to such prestigious programs at the Harid Conservatory, the Joffrey Ballet, University of NC School of the Arts, and have gone on to dance professionally on stage and the big screen. Ms. Ashley has won multiple Judges’ Choice/Entertainment Awards and countless regional and national Best Choreography Awards year after year. Not only does she serve as a top and innovative choreographer for many studios and companies throughout the southeastern U.S., but she also serves as a dance judge for several regional and national dance competitions.

She is a certified teaching professional through Dance Masters of America and Carolina Dance Masters, Inc. in Ballet and Acrobatics. Additionally, Ashley is certified and attends continued education and annual recertification through Progressing Ballet Technique (PBT) as well as certified as a teaching aerial artist.  Outside of dance training and certifications, Ashley earned her B.A. Degree in Spanish from the University of NC at Wilmington.

Her love of dance was the driving force behind her decision to become a teacher, hoping to inspire other hearts to love dance as she has. She continues to push and encourage kids to be their absolute best always because as she says, “If you know better, do better” and it is important to her that children know the power they have not just as artists, but as people who can change the world.

Mikayla Moore

Ballet, Lyrical, Contemporary, Jazz, Acro, & Hip Hop

Mikayla has been dancing for 11 years and has trained under Ashley O'Quinn for the majority of those years. She is a DADC member, a TA, as well as a full time instructor at Dance Ascension. Mikayla has won numerous overall scores and special awards over the years as a competitor. She also has experience in choreographing her solos and was a featured dancer for Dance Ascension's Saturday Night Student Spotlight. Mikayla has been accepted into a variety of dance programs including, but not limited to, UNCSA and Joffrey Ballet School. While teaching, she plans to continue training and growing her artistry to pursue her dream of becoming a professional dancer and choreographer.

Maggie-Kate Howard

Ballet & Pointe

Maggie-Kate Howard began training at age 4. She attended Booker T. Washington Highschool for the Performing and Visual Arts and graduated with the Kevin Brown Award for Outstanding Performance in Ballet. She has attended ABT, PNB, and Carolina Ballet summer-intensive programs. In 2021, Maggie-Kate joined the School of Carolina Ballet as a full scholarship pre-professional student.

Sabrina Reeves

Administrator

Sabrina Reeves began her dance career at the age of 5 and studied tap, jazz, ballet, & pointe over the years.   Tap is her specialty and is near and dear to her heart.   She has done choreography part-time for numerous tap routines for pageant contestants and various dance routines for competition teams.  She also served as the Clinton High School Dance Team instructor for three years and coached High School Cheerleading for nine years.  Mrs. Sabrina competed in numerous pageants, winning her high school title, and placing as runners-up in Miss America/North Carolina Preliminary Pageants.  She served on the Board of the Miss Spivey's Corner Scholarship Pageant for 19 years from 2000 to 2019.  During that time, Mrs. Sabrina served as Production Coordinator, Contestant Coordinator, Business Manager, and Executive Director.  She also does pageant coaching/consulting, interview prep, and hair/make-up for pageant contestants.  She has also done hair & make-up for wedding parties.  Mrs. Sabrina has worked with girls who have competed in high school pageants, community pageants, and state pageants.  Mrs. Sabrina served as the choreographer for the Sampson County Christmas Show in 2019.  She & her husband, Robert, reside in Clinton, and have three children, Kyle, Tyler, & Mady, and their dog, Tucker.  Mady, has been a competitive dancer for the past 7 years and has won numerous awards in the advanced categories. Mrs. Sabrina is a member of Grove Park Baptist Church, where she teaches Sunday School for 4th - 5th Grade and is a member of the Praise Team.  She is also a high school Math teacher at Clinton High School, where she is the Miss Clinton High School Pageant Director, Clinton High School Prom Co-Chair, and serves on the CHS Leadership Team and Department Representative for Math for the Clinton City School District.

Olivia Palacios

Ballet, Tap, & Jazz

Olivia is a local to our area. She trained in Ballet, Tap, Jazz, Lyrical, Contemporary and Hip Hop for 17 years. She began her competitive dance training at the age of 11 competing in many styles including tap, ballet, jazz, contemporary, hip hop and pom. Her two favorite styles are tap and pom! While attending the University of North Carolina at Greensboro, she was on a college dance team, the Spartan G’s! She currently teaches dance at Corinth Holders High School in addition to teaching at Dance Ascension. 
Olivia is a certified aerial instructor and attends continued education courses annually to ensure our students receive the best training she can provide.
